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use our industrial-strength pumps to extract the water from your property, and our high-capacity vacuums to dry out the area. Our team will work quickly and efficiently to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use our industrial-strength dehumidifiers to dry out the area and remove any remaining moisture. Our team will work to reduce the risk of mold and mildew growth by using antimicrobial treatments and air scrubbers to remove any airborne pathogens.

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leaning

Once the drying and dehumidification process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your property is safe and odor-free. We’ll clean and disinfect the area to prevent any further damage or health risks.

After Hours Water Removal Cost in Port Orchard, WA

The cost of after hours water removal in Port Orchard, WA can vary based on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as the local conditions in the area. Here are some estimated prices for common scenarios: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Small leak in a bathroom or kitchen $500 – $2,500 The size and location of the leak, as well as the type of equipment needed to extract the water.
Major flood in a living room or hallway $2,500 – $10,000 The size and location of the flood, as well as the amount of equipment and personnel needed to extract the water and dry out the area.
Water damage in a crawl space or attic $1,000 – $5,000 The size and location of the area affected, as well as the type of equipment needed to access and clean the area.
Hidden water damage behind walls or under flooring $2,000 – $10,000 The size and location of the area affected, as well as the type of equipment and personnel needed to detect and fix the problem.
Water damage in a commercial building or rental property $5,000 – $20,000 The size and location of the area affected, as well as the type of equipment and personnel needed to contain the damage, dry out the area, and prevent further damage.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and free estimates are available.
